Uses for A Wesite in the classroom

I just received this email from David, a teacher in Israel. He says:

I've been using it for about a year....
Kids use is quite a bit.
  • Class handouts
  • Test review
  • Grades
  • Pictures
  • Link to other sites related to subject matte

No worries I'll be doing another workshop would should be improved as I gain more experience. With regards to changing a site name, I ran into the same problem myself . It seems that google will allow you to have four different web addresses. To add a new one, just go to the "Site Manager" page of "Page Creator". On the top right hand side of the page you should see a scroll down menu named "Choose another site". Click on it and select "Create another site". From there it should be smooth sailing.
